>I'm developing a report that uses multiple columns (like the phone book) - two element in each column.
>The answers I found on the web seems awfully kludgy. I'd have to develop a column number field in each row and use pass that to the report.
>Crystal Reports and the VFP report writer support multiple columns themselves.
>Is that the only way with SSRS?

Hi, Bill,

Depending on the actual format, there "might" be other ways. Sometimes if I shape the results of a query into something along the lines of a pivot table, I can "fake out" SSRS by using a matrix.

Might seem strange, but can you sketch out the output you're looking for, and can you provide the structure (fields/columns) of the data being used for the report. Can't swear I'll be able to help, but I'll try.
